Principles of Concrete Pneumatic Conveying

The core principle of concrete pneumatic conveying involves the use of compressed air to generate a flow of material through a pipeline. The system typically consists of a hopper, a blower or compressor, and a pipeline network. When the material is introduced into the hopper, the air is activated, creating a vacuum or pressure differential that propels the concrete through the system. This method eliminates the need for traditional conveyor belts or trucks, reducing labor costs and minimizing material spillage. The technology is based on the physics of fluidization and the behavior of particulate materials under airflow, ensuring consistent and controlled delivery of concrete to the desired location.

Key Components and Their Functions

Several critical components work in tandem to ensure the effective operation of a concrete pneumatic conveying system. The hopper serves as the material storage and feeding unit, allowing for continuous or batch loading of concrete. The blower or compressor provides the necessary air pressure, with options ranging from positive pressure systems (where air pushes material) to negative pressure systems (where air pulls material). The pipeline network, often made of stainless steel or other corrosion-resistant materials, transmits the concrete from the source to the destination. Additionally, control valves and filters are essential for regulating airflow and preventing blockages, ensuring smooth operation and material quality.

Application Scenarios and Operational Advantages

Concrete pneumatic conveying systems are widely applied in various construction scenarios, particularly where traditional methods are impractical. In high-rise building projects, these systems enable the vertical transport of concrete from ground-level mixing stations to upper floors, eliminating the need for external lifts or cranes. This reduces construction time and improves safety by minimizing the number of personnel on elevated platforms. In industrial settings, such as large-scale infrastructure projects like dams or bridges, the systems facilitate the efficient delivery of concrete to remote or hard-to-reach areas, enhancing productivity and reducing material handling costs. Furthermore, in environments with limited space or complex layouts, the flexibility of pneumatic conveying allows for customized pipeline configurations, adapting to the specific requirements of each project.

Operational Considerations and Maintenance

While concrete pneumatic conveying offers numerous benefits, proper operation and maintenance are essential for optimal performance. Regular inspection of the pipeline for leaks or blockages is crucial to prevent system inefficiencies. The blower or compressor must be maintained to ensure consistent air pressure, as fluctuations can affect material flow. Additionally, cleaning the system after each use or at regular intervals is necessary to prevent material buildup and maintain air quality. The use of appropriate filters and moisture control measures helps to preserve the quality of the concrete and extend the lifespan of the equipment. By adhering to these operational guidelines, construction companies can maximize the efficiency and reliability of their concrete pneumatic conveying systems.
